⚠ Common Pitfall in Huntsville
Since Huntsville sits on Sam Houston State University's doorstep, Development Services often flags ADU applications near campus-adjacent neighborhoods for extra zoning review to confirm the unit won't function as informal student housing, which is a separate check from the standard building permit and can add real back-and-forth. Also, because STRs aren't allowed citywide, you'll want written confirmation from the city that your ADU's intended use (family member, long-term rental, etc.) is documented in the permit file — inspectors have been known to ask for proof of occupancy type during final inspection, not just at submission. Many older Huntsville lots also still run on shared or undersized water taps, so the city's utility department may require a separate tap-and-meter upgrade fee before they'll sign off, a cost that isn't in the standard building permit fee schedule.

What is an as-built floor plan and why do I need one in Huntsville? +
An as-built floor plan documents your home as it currently exists — including all room dimensions, door and window locations, wall thicknesses, and square footage. These are required when the original permit drawings are unavailable or the home was modified without permits. Huntsville's building department requires accurate as-builts when you apply for renovation or addition permits on older homes.
